Introduction
A brain tumor is a mass or abnormal growth of cells in the brain. Many types of brain tumors exist. Some brain tumors are noncancerous (benign) and some brain tumors are not cancerous (malignant). Brain tumors can be in the brain (primary brain tumors), or to begin cancer, can in other parts of the body and the spread of the brain to start brain tumors (metastatic or secondary).

The number of brain tumors diagnosed each year is rising. There are signs that the increase is practiced for decades. But we do not know why.

Treatment
The treatment of a brain tumor depends on the type, size and location of the tumor and your general health and your preferences. Your doctor may treat the individual specific to your situation.
